What is the best area to stay in Peel Island when booking a holiday rental?
When planning a holiday rental on Peel Island, Queensland, one of the best areas to consider is near the historic remnants of the Peel Island Lazaret, which offers a fascinating glimpse into the island's past as a leprosy colony. Staying in this vicinity allows you to explore the island's rich history while enjoying beautiful views of Moreton Bay.

Another excellent option is the area closer to the island's stunning beaches, such as the picturesque sandy shores of the eastern side. This location not only provides easy access to swimming and sunbathing but also opportunities for snorkelling and enjoying the vibrant marine life around the island.

When is the best time to visit Peel Island for a holiday rental?
The best time to visit Peel Island for a holiday rental is during the peak season from November to January, with December being particularly popular. This period attracts travellers looking to soak up the sun, enjoy the beautiful beaches, and explore the natural wonders of the island. With temperatures often reaching the mid-30s Celsius, the warm weather makes it ideal for outdoor activities such as swimming, snorkelling, and hiking along scenic trails.

In December, visitors can expect a vibrant atmosphere, as numerous holiday festivities and events take place, enhancing the sense of community. The clear blue skies and pleasant sea breezes create a superb backdrop for relaxation and adventure alike.

For those seeking a quieter experience, May is an excellent time to consider. The weather remains mild, with average temperatures around 25 degrees Celsius, making it comfortable for exploring the island's stunning landscapes without the crowds. This month offers a peaceful retreat, allowing you to enjoy the natural beauty of Peel Island at a more leisurely pace.
